I copy a VHS tape or DVD from an external player Yes but only if the VHS tape or DVD is not copy protected What are Titles and Chapters A DVD disc contains Titles and Chapters which are similar to the Titles and Chapters of a book A Title is often a complete movie and is broken down into Chapters or individual scenes from the movies lt Title J Chapter lt Tite gt Chapter Chapter Chapter Chapter chapter markers Programs are recorded as a single title it may consist of one chapter or a few chapters within a title depending on the recording settings How do set up Titles and Chapters The recorder automatically creates a new Title every time you start a new recording You can then add Chapters to these recordings manually or have them automatically inserted at 5 minutes intervals What does finalizing a disc do Finalizing a disc locks the disc so it can no longer be used for recording This is only required for DVDR discs It will then be compatible with virtually any DVD player To remove a disc without finalizing it simply stop recording and eject the disc You will still be able to record on the disc if there is storage space for more recordings How good is the quality of the recording There are a few quality levels to choose from ranging from HQ High Quality 1 hour mode to SLP Super Long Play 6 hours mode Press

39. er Power supply 110 240 VAC 50 60 Hz Consumption 25 W typical Standby power consumption lt 3W Cabinet Dimensions W x H x D 360 x 43 x 322 mm Net Weight 3 kg 59 Frequently Asked Questions What kind of disc should I use for recording You can record on both DVDR and DVD RW discs They are compatible with DVD Video players and DVD ROM drives in computers What is the capacity of a DWDtR ERW disc 4 7GB or equivalent to six CDs You can store only one hour of recordings on a single disc at the highest quality DVD standard and about 6 hours recordings at the lowest quality VHS standard What is the difference between DVD R and DVDiRW DVDER is recordable and DVDRW is rewritable With a DVDR you can record multiple sessions on the same disc but when the disc is full you cannot record any more on the disc The DVD RW allows you to record over the same disc repeatedly What is DV Using DV also known as i LINK you can connect a DV equipped camcorder to this recorder using a single DV cable for input and output of audio video data and control signals This recorder is only compatible with DV format DVC SD camcorders Digital satellite tuners and Digital VHS video recorders are not compatible You cannot connect more than one DV camcorder at a time to this recorder You cannot control this recorder from external equipment connected via the DV IN jack Can

47. interactive playback and searching PCM Pulse Code Modulation A digital audio encoding system Parental control Limits disc play according to the age of the users or the limitation level in each country The limitation varies from disc to disc when it is activated playback will be prohibited if the software s level is higher than the user set level Region code A system allowing discs to be played only in the region designated This unit will only play discs that have compatible region codes You can find the region code of your unit by looking on the product label Some discs are compatible with more than one region or ALL regions S Video Produces a clear picture by sending separate signals for the luminance and the colour You can use S Video only if your TV has an S Video In jack Surround A system for creating realistic three dimensional sound fields full of realism by arranging multiple speakers around the listener Title The longest section of a movie or music feature on DVD Each title is assigned a title number enabling you to locate the title you want VIDEO OUT jack Yellow jack on the back of the DVD system that sends the DVD picture video to a TV 6l Display panel symbols messages The following symbols messages may appear on your recorder display 00 00 00 Multifunction display text line Title track number Total elasped remaining title track time Additional informat
48. ion regarding the disc TV channel number or source of video Clock This is displayed in Standby mode TV program title BLANK There are no recordings on the disc in the tray FULL Disc is full There is no storage space for new recordings LOADING Disc is being recognized by the recorder MENU The system setup menu disc menu title menu or timer menu display is on NO DISC No disc has been inserted If a disc has been inserted then it is possible that the disc cannot be read OPEN Disc tray is opening or opened PHOTO A picture disc has been inserted REGION When the DVD inserted is in a wrong region code as the recorder STARTUP The recorder has been turned on STOP When playback recording is stopped TOPMENU The recorder is in TOP MENU mode TIMER A timer recording has been programmed or is active UPDATE The recorder is writing to the disc UNKNOWN The recorder has encountered an error in handling the disc inserted 63

59. ptions of an item in the menu Press SYSTEM MENU to exit the menu 21 Recording Discs for recording Several different formats of DVD recordable discs can be used with this recorder ZYD RW DVD ReWritable DVD RW DVD Rewritable Discs that are rewritable can be used for multiple recordings once the existing data has been erased Em 2 DVD R R DVD R DVD Recordable Discs can only be used for a single recording Each new recording is always added at the end of all previous recordings as existing recordings cannot be overwritten Editing can be made on any DVD R discs as long as they have not been finalized It is also possible to create additional chapter markers To playa DVD R on another DVD player it must be finalized See the chapter Editing Finalizing Recording Playing your recordings DVD R on other DVD players After this is done no more data can be added to the disc Supported disc types and media speeds Disc Media speeds DVD R Ix 16x DVD RW 2 4 x 4x DVD R Ix 16x DVD RW 2x 4x IMPORTANT Unrecordable pictures Television programs films video tapes discs and other materials may be copy protected and therefore cannot be recorded on this recorder Recording settings The default recording settings allow you to set the auto chapter markers preferred recording input source and recording mode
